`
hudeyong926
  • 浏览: 2019298 次
  • 来自: 武汉
社区版块
存档分类
最新评论

重置 MySQL 自增列 AUTO_INCREMENT值

阅读更多

注意, 使用以下任意方法都会将现有数据删除.

方法一:

delete from tb1;
ALTER TABLE tbl AUTO_INCREMENT = 100;

(好处, 可以设置 AUTO_INCREMENT 为任意值开始)
提示:如果表列和数据很多, 速度会很慢, 如90多万条, 会在10分钟以上
如果auto_increment=值小于max(id),ID从max(ID)+1开始计数


方法二:
truncate tb1;
(好处, 简单, AUTO_INCREMENT 值重新开始计数.)

分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ics